If (8z − 9)(8z + 9) = az2 − b, what is the value of a?

Answer:  a = 64

Explanation:

We use the difference of squares rule to say

(m-n)(m+n) = m^2 - n^2

So in this particular case,

(8z-9)(8z+9) = (8z)^2-(9)^2 = 64z^2 - 81

We can see that the 64 matches with the 'a' of the expression az^2-81, which must mean a = 64

Side note: This means b = 81
